If you travel down York Road towards Leeds, as you pass Great Clothes you might spot a temporary yellow sign that was put up to direct traffic to the Euro '96 football match that was held at Elland Road.That would mean that this 'temporary' sign has been in place for nearly 13 years! Does anyone know of any older temporary signs, or is this a record?
